The robotic endoluminal surgery market size has grown rapidly in recent years. It will grow from $1.45 billion in 2025 to $1.71 billion in 2026 at a compound annual growth rate (CAGR) of 18.4%. The growth in the historic period can be attributed to increasing demand for minimally invasive procedures, rising adoption of endoscopic technologies, growing preference for shorter hospital stays, expanding use of robotic-assisted surgeries, increasing precision requirements for hard-to-reach anatomies.

The robotic endoluminal surgery market size is expected to see rapid growth in the next few years. It will grow to $3.33 billion in 2030 at a compound annual growth rate (CAGR) of 18.1%. The growth in the forecast period can be attributed to rising investment in surgical robotics research, growing integration of ai and machine learning in surgical platforms, increasing commercialization of flexible robotic systems, expanding clinical applications across gastrointestinal and vascular procedures, rising patient preference for faster recovery and reduced trauma. Major trends in the forecast period include technology advancements in flexible robotic endoscopes, innovations in capsule and micro-robotic devices, developments in ai-enabled navigation systems, research and developments in autonomous robotic surgery, advancements in real-time imaging and robotic visualization systems.

The growing adoption of minimally invasive surgeries is expected to drive the growth of the robotic endoluminal surgery market in the coming years. Minimally invasive surgeries are procedures performed through small incisions or a single entry point, reducing patient trauma, recovery time, and the risk of complications. Their adoption is increasing as hospitals and patients prioritize shorter recovery periods, less postoperative pain, lower complication risks, and minimal scarring compared with traditional open surgeries. Robotic endoluminal surgery facilitates these procedures by enabling precise navigation and manipulation within internal lumens, such as the gastrointestinal or respiratory tracts. It enhances patient outcomes by minimizing tissue trauma, shortening recovery times, and improving procedural accuracy. For example, in January 2025, Intuitive Surgical Inc., a US-based medical technology company, reported that worldwide da Vinci procedures - a type of minimally invasive robotic-assisted surgery - grew approximately 18% in the fourth quarter of 2024 compared with the same period in 2023. Full-year 2024 procedures increased about 17% compared with 2023, and the company projects worldwide da Vinci procedures to grow approximately 13% to 16% in 2025 compared with 2024. Consequently, the rising adoption of minimally invasive and single-port surgeries is fueling the expansion of the robotic endoluminal surgery market.

Major companies in the robotic endoluminal surgery market are focusing on developing advanced technologies, such as integrated artificial intelligence (AI) and real-time imaging systems, to enhance procedural accuracy, improve patient safety, and boost diagnostic efficiency. Integrated AI and advanced imaging systems combine machine learning with live procedural data to help physicians navigate complex anatomy and identify tissue targets with greater precision. For example, in October 2025, Intuitive Surgical Inc., a US-based medical technology company, received U.S. Food & Drug Administration (FDA) clearance for software enhancements for its Ion endoluminal system. The cleared innovations include improved 3D visualization of the lung airway tree and integration of AI-based imaging functionality, assisting in the detection of suspicious lung lesions during biopsy procedures. This integration is designed to provide more intuitive navigation and actionable information, supporting physician decision-making for precise tissue sampling and enhancing early lung cancer diagnosis, potentially improving patient outcomes.

In July 2025, Olympus Corporation, a Japan-based global medical technology company, partnered with Revival Healthcare Capital to establish Swan EndoSurgical, a new company focused on advancing robotic endoluminal surgery systems. Through this collaboration, Olympus and Revival Healthcare Capital aim to develop a novel robotic platform to transform gastrointestinal (GI) patient care by providing enhanced precision, flexibility, and control for endoluminal procedures. Revival Healthcare Capital is a US-based healthcare private equity and investment firm.

Tariffs are impacting the robotic endoluminal surgery market by increasing costs of imported robotic arms, flexible robotic instruments, imaging modules, control systems, and specialized surgical accessories. hospitals and ambulatory surgical centers in north america and europe are most affected due to reliance on imported advanced surgical robotics, while asia-pacific faces cost pressures in system manufacturing and distribution. these tariffs are increasing system acquisition costs and slowing adoption in mid-sized facilities. however, they are also encouraging domestic production, localized system integration, and regional innovation in cost-optimized robotic endoluminal platforms.

Robotic endoluminal surgery refers to the use of robot-assisted systems to perform minimally invasive procedures within hollow organs and natural body lumens, such as blood vessels, the gastrointestinal tract, and airways. These systems allow precise navigation, visualization, and manipulation of instruments within narrow and complex anatomical structures that are challenging to access with conventional surgery. By enhancing control, dexterity, and stability within internal passages, robotic endoluminal platforms improve surgical accuracy, minimize tissue trauma, and support faster patient recovery.

The primary product types of robotic endoluminal surgery systems are surgical systems, accessories and instruments, and services. Surgical systems are robotic platforms designed to perform minimally invasive procedures within hollow organs through natural orifices or small incisions. These systems are used in applications including gastrointestinal surgery, urological surgery, pulmonary surgery, gynecological surgery, and others, among end users such as hospitals, ambulatory surgical centers, specialty clinics, and others.
